"The enterprise network model has shifted from a centralised, contained system to a decentralised, open one. In the past, valuable assets were stored inside a trusted corporate network, much like cash in a bank vault. Now, assets are distributed everywhere. On laptops in coffee shops, in SaaS applications and across multiple clouds. They are no longer vaulted. They are operating in the equivalent of a public square."
"Attempting to secure this environment with methods that worked in the past no longer does the job. Complicating matters, many vendors market 'unified' platforms that are merely collections of acquired products stitched together. This integration theatre gives the illusion of a comprehensive solution but lacks the truly unified architecture needed to manage a distributed environment, leaving gaps that increase complexity and risk."
"CISOs now face two strategic decisions. First, to distinguish solutions offering true, deep integration from those that are merely integration theatre. And second, to architect a genuinely unified platform that builds resilience. Making the right choices will ultimately be what separates a costly security incident from a business that earns and keeps customer trust."
The traditional corporate network perimeter no longer exists as employees work remotely, applications span multiple clouds, and devices connect globally. Assets are now distributed across laptops, SaaS applications, and cloud platforms rather than secured within centralized corporate networks. Legacy security approaches like adding firewalls prove ineffective in this environment. Many vendors offer superficial solutions through integration theatre—combining acquired products without true unified architecture. CISOs must shift strategy from protecting fixed perimeters to securing assets wherever they operate. Distinguishing genuinely integrated platforms from collections of stitched-together products is critical for building resilience and preventing costly security incidents.
